View of the main facade of the Palais des Papes in Avignon, with an inscription indicating that part of it was built under Clement VI (1342-1352) and that the heraldic symbols are still present above the entrance door and at the vault keys. Reverse: handwritten message addressed to Mme Élvanne de la Croise in Nanteuil (Seine), sent from Avignon by Charles and Marie, with a violet 40-centime stamp and a cancellation from Avignon post office.
